Hello I own lokayswoodgrain@aol.com We do the orginal style woodgraining that the manufacture did on your car. The first step is to remove all orginal finish down to the metal and start from scratch. We put the base color on first then we print the orginal patern and color of wood grain on it. After that we clear coat and let it sit for two weeks to cure. Then we wet sand and buff to a high luster. All work is perfect or it will not leave the shop! My wife says I'm to pickey but right is right and wrong is wrong.
